Saudi Bank Profits Up by Two Thirds
Third quarter profits for Saudi Arabia's banks are up two-thirds over theirlevel last year and are more than four times higher than in 1987. This is basedon the results of nine of the twelve commercial banks in the Kingdom, but excludes National Commercial Bank (NCB) which, as a private bank, is not obligedto report quarterly results, despite being the largest bank in the country,...
